#4 United's pace in attack is proving unstoppable

In all the pre-season games we have seen United play, they have looked devastating on the break. With the likes of Daniel James, Mason Greenwood, and Martial, United owned the Tottenham defense throughout the first half. So much so that James alone was fouled in the final-third more than three times and one of the fouls from Moussa Sissoko should have been a straight red.

Early in the game, United's press caused Tottenham a lot of problems as Martial hit the post early on when James pressed Sissoko into making a mistake and unleashing Martial through on goal. In the second half though, the pressing from the different front three of Rashford, Mata and Gomes was a little bit disjointed but that doesn't take away the fact that United have shown a lot of pace in the attacking third throughout the pre-season.
